8 Functional Check
A functional check might be required for one of the following reasons:
Initial startup
Routine functional check
Suspicion of monitoring system malfunction
Modicationofmonitoringsystem(e.g.integrationofadditionalsensorordevice)
Change of measuring location
Depending on the application (water composition), the probes and sensors connected and the environmental conditions a
regular functional check (weekly to monthly) is recommended. The following sections provide an overview of all the actions
that have to be performed to check the monitoring system quickly (see section 8.1). To check the plausibility of the displayed
and collected readings and the integrity of a single probe or sensor, please refer to the according manuals of the connected
probes and sensors.
